Masked gunmen rob business establishment on VG

Virgin Gorda Police Station: Officers of the Criminal Investigations Department of the Royal Virgin Islands Police Force (RVIPF) are said to be in active pursuit of two gunmen who robbed VG Graphics on Virgin Gorda on September 4, 2019. Photo: VINO/File
VALLEY, Virgin Gorda, VI – A business establishment on Virgin Gorda fell victim to masked gunmen on Wednesday, September 4, 2019.

According to a press release from the Royal Virgin Islands Police Force (RVIPF) this evening, September 6, 2019, two masked gunmen entered the establishment known as VG Graphics, adjacent Prince Bar “in the early hours” demanding cash.

It said a total of $30.00 in cash and coins was stolen and the perpetrators fled the scene on foot. The victims received no injuries during the robbery.

The suspects are described as slim built and approximately 5ft 5’. At the time they were wearing all black with masks on their faces.

Officers of the Criminal Investigations Department are said to be in active pursuit of the robbers.

Persons with information on the identity of these suspects are asked to contact the Virgin Gorda Police Station directly or call the RVIPF access number 311. Persons can also call the RVIPF Intelligence Unit at 368-9339.

“All information will be held in the strictest confidence,” the RVIPF assured.
